KEYSTART 9700 series
MANUAL START ENGINE CONTROLLER WITH
AUTOMATIC FAULT PROTECTION SHUTDOWN
The Keystart 9700 range provides for the manual starting and
stopping of a standby engine - a generator, pump or other
application - with automatic monitoring and shutdown of the
engine in the event of a fault.
The 9700 series is pin compatible with the Autostart range:
this allows the use of standard wiring for both manual and
automatic control panels, simplifying panel design and
permitting easy upgrades from a manual to fully automatic
control system.
Key features
 Keyswitch operation for enhanced security
 Up to four fault inputs, configurable for use with contacts
which open or close on fault, with wiring to +ve or –ve DC
 Options for overspeed protection (magnetic pickup or 
AC alternator driven) and preheat/auxiliary control.
 Pin compatible with Autostart 705, 710, 720 and 730 series.
 96 x 96mm DIN standard, front panel mounted case
 Switchable 12 or 24 V DC power supply
Operation
The Keystart is powered from the engine battery or similar
low voltage DC source. A switch at the rear allows for 12V
or 24V operation.
Control of the Keystart and engine is by use of a 3 or 4
position keyswitch on the front facia:-
STOP
Removes power from the Keystart, stopping the
engine and resetting a latched fault condition.
RUN
Energises the Keystart’s RUN relay (enabling
the engine fuel or ignition). The fault ‘override’
timer begins as soon as the key is turned (or
spring returns) to this position. Once the engine
is fully running, Keystart monitors for faults and
shuts down the engine if a fault is detected.
START Maintains fuel to the engine, and activates the
START output (used for controlling the starter
motor circuit). This position is spring-biased to
return to the RUN position when the operator
releases the key.
AUX
(optional: 'A' models only) Provides a switched
+ve DC output, used for preheat circuits or
auxiliary control (remote power up) of Keystart.
The key is common to all Keystarts and is removable
only in the STOP position.
The front facia also has five LED and pictogram indicators
for the display of engine fault status:-
Low Oil Pressure
High Engine Temperature
Overspeed (or Plant Fail on non-overspeed units)
Charge Fail
Plant Fail
